Icebreaker Toolkit: Simple First Messages That Actually Work
Feeling unsure what to say first is normal. Use low-pressure, profile-based openers that invite a short reply and let conversation grow naturally.
Quick patterns to adapt
- Observation + question: Spot something specific in their profile or photos and ask a light follow-up. Example: “I noticed your hiking photo—what trail was that?”
- Two-choice prompt: Give an easy binary pick to avoid open-ended pressure. Example: “Beach day or city museum—which would you choose?”
- Curiosity hook: Mention a small detail and ask for the backstory. Example: “That coffee cup looks interesting—is there a story behind it?”
- Playful callout: Gentle, friendly tease tied to their profile. Example: “You say you’re a movie nerd—what’s your one movie you’d make everyone watch?”
How to avoid bland or awkward openers
- Skip generic compliments: Replace “You’re pretty” with something concrete: “Your smile in that concert photo looks like you were having a blast—what band was playing?”
- Don’t start with heavy topics: Avoid deep or intense questions on first message. Keep it light and curiosity-driven.
- Personalize, don’t overthink: Even one specific detail is enough. A short line that references their profile beats a long paragraph of flattery.
- No copy-paste lines: If you reuse a pattern, tweak it so it fits the person you’re messaging—change names, details, or the tone.
Follow-up tips that keep things moving
- Use callbacks: If they answer, reference part of their reply to show you listened. Example: “That trail sounds great—any sections you’d recommend for beginners?”
- Trim long messages early: Short replies are fine at first; match their length and energy.
- End with an easy next step: Ask a small, time-bound question that invites another quick reply: “Morning person or night owl? I’m trying to plan a weekend coffee run.”
These patterns are easy to customize and reduce pressure—for both of you. Pick one, adapt it to the profile, and keep it curious and kind. Small, specific details beat grand statements every time.
